Eurohold Bulgaria increases its revenues and profitability in 9M2025

11 December 2025 — Marina MAGNAVAL
One of the leading energy and financial groups in Southeast Europe - Eurohold Bulgaria AD, increased its revenues for the first nine months of 2025 by 12.2% to BGN 2.31 billion (EUR 1.18 billion) as well as its net financial result nearly three times to BGN 94.6 million (EUR 48.37 million).

According to the report of Eurohold Bulgaria, operating profit before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ization (EBITDA) increased by 23.1% year-on-year to BGN 295.69 million (EUR 151.18 million).

It is noted that performance of the parent company contributed significantly to the financial result. The holding's assets increased by 7.9% year-on-year to BGN 2.97 billion (EUR 1.52 billion). Revenue from energy activities, which form a large part of the holding's business, reached BGN 1.8 billion (EUR 920 million) for the first nine months of 2025, which is 14.8% more than in the same period of the previous year.

Insurance revenues and EBITDA increased by 4.4% and 36.2% respectively for the year to BGN 516.85 million (EUR 264.26 million) and BGN 22.48 million (EUR 11.49 million).

Eurohold operates in the energy and insurance sectors through the Electrohold and Euroins groups.
